Factors Determining GATE Cutoff:
IIT Roorkee will release the GATE cutoff for this year after the GATE 2025 results are announced. Several factors can impact the GATE cutoff.
1. The difficulty level of the exam is one of the most critical factors that influence the cutoff. If the exam is particularly challenging, the cutoff is likely to be lower than it would be for an easier exam. Conversely, if the exam is relatively straightforward, the cutoff will likely be higher.
2. The number of candidates who take the exam also impacts the cutoff scores. This year, around 8 lakh candidates applied for GATE 2025, which is a considerably higher number than last year. With the increase in the number of test-takers, the GATE cutoff scores are expected to rise.
3. The number of candidates who successfully complete the examination is also directly correlated with the cutoff scores.
4. Lastly, the number of available seats can affect the GATE cutoff. If an institute has a limited number of seats, the competition for those seats will be higher, which can lead to a higher cutoff score.

GATE Cutoff Trends Previous Year Analysis
GATE 2024 Cutoff
Paper Code | Test Paper | GATE 2024 Official Cutoff | ||
Cut-off (GEN) | Cut-off (OBC-NCL/EWS) | Cut-off (SC/ST/PwD) | ||
AE | Aerospace Engineering | 33.3 | 29.9 | 22.1 |
AG | Agricultural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
AR | Architecture and Planning | 41.5 | 37.3 | 27.6 |
BM | Biomedical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
BT | Biotechnology | 38.9 | 35 | 25.9 |
CE | Civil Engineering | 28.3 | 25.4 | 18.8 |
CH | Chemical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
CS | Computer Science and Information Technology | 27.6 | 24.8 | 18.4 |
CY | Chemistry | 25.2 | 22.6 | 16.7 |
DA | Data Science and Artificial Intelligence | 37.1 | 33.3 | 24.7 |
EC | Electronics and Communication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
EE | Electrical Engineering | 25.7 | 23.1 | 17.1 |
ES | Environmental Science and Engineering | 37.9 | 34.1 | 25.2 |
EY | Ecology and Evolution | 35.8 | 32.2 | 23.8 |
GE | Geomatics Engineering | 41.1 | 36.9 | 27.4 |
GG1 | Geology and Geophysics (Geology) | 42 | 37.8 | 28 |
GG2 | Geology and Geophysics (Geophysics) | 49 | 44.1 | 32.6 |
IN | Instrumentation Engineering | 32.7 | 29.4 | 21.8 |
MA | Mathematics |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
ME | Mechanical Engineering | 28.6 | 25.7 | 19 |
MN | Mining Engineering |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
MT | Metallurgical Engineering | 41 | 36.9 | 27.3 |
NM | Naval Architecture and Marine Engineering | 25.1 | 22.5 | 16.7 |
PE | Petroleum Engineering | 42.6 | 38.3 | 28.4 |
PH | Physics | 32 | 28.8 | 21.3 |
PI | Production and Industrial Engineering | 30.5 | 27.4 | 20.3 |
ST | Statistics | 26.6 | 23.9 | 17.7 |
TF | Textile Engineering and Fibre Science | 28.1 | 25.2 | 18.7 |
XE | Engineering Sciences | 36.2 | 32.5 | 24.1 |
XH-C1 | Humanities and Social Sciences (Economics) | 37 | 33.3 | 24.6 |
XH-C2 | Humanities and Social Sciences (English) | 48 | 43.2 | 32 |
XH-C3 | Humanities and Social Sciences (Linguistics) | 49.7 | 44.7 | 33.1 |
XH-C4 | Humanities and Social Sciences (Philosophy) | 39.3 | 35.3 | 26.1 |
XH-C5 | Humanities and Social Sciences (Psychology) | 52.7 | 47.4 | 35.1 |
XH-C6 | Humanities and Social Sciences (Sociology) | 36 | 32.4 | 24 |
XL | Life Sciences | 29.3 | 26.3 | 19.5 |

GATE 2023 Cutoff
Branch | GATE 2023 Official Cutoff | ||
General | OBC-NCL/EWS | SC/ST/PWD | |
Civil Engineering (CE) | 26.6 | 23.9 | 17.7 |
Mechanical Engineering (ME) | 28.4 | 25.5 | 18.9 |
Electrical Engineering (EE) | 25 | 22.5 | 16.6 |
Electronics & Communication Engineering (EC) | 29.9 | 26.9 | 19.9 |
Computer Science & Information Technology (CS) | 32.5 | 29.2 | 21.6 |

Remember, the official GATE cutoff, as released by the conducting institute (IIT Roorkee in the case of 2025), is only a preliminary indication of whether you’ve passed the GATE exam or not. For final admission cutoffs, you’ll have to refer to the official website of each institute.
